When Is Bankruptcy Necessary?
There is no hard cut-off point where bankruptcy becomes an absolute necessity. Instead, you will have to make a judgment based on your individual circumstances.
If you are facing significant pressure from debt collectors, it may be time to consider filing for bankruptcy as a possible solution. When you file for bankruptcy, your creditors must cease all of their attempts to seize your assets until your period of bankruptcy ends. This can give you the time you need to stabilize and catch up on your debts.

Can I Keep My Property in Chapter 13 Bankruptcy?
Many people associate bankruptcy with selling your property to pay off your debts. However, this is not true of Chapter 13 bankruptcy. Instead of liquidating your assets, you pay off your creditors by contributing to a repayment plan over the course of years. For this reason, chapter 13 bankruptcy can be a very valuable tool for protecting your home from foreclosure.
If you have a stable income that allows you to make regular payments on a repayment plan, Chapter 13 bankruptcy may be right for you. As long as you do not fall behind on your repayment plan, this form of bankruptcy can give you some protection against asset seizure.
